Demographics & Identity in Wollondilly

Who lives here — how many people, how old they are, and how communities identify.

A much higher share of children than the national average defines the population of Wollondilly. This area is notably younger than most similar regions, with a typical resident aged 37. It is a growing community that has expanded by 25% since 2011.

Population

How many people, and the typical age.

The population of Wollondilly has grown by about 10,702 people since 2011, reaching a total of 53,961. This makes it larger than about 78% of similar areas.

Age profile

How the population splits across age groups.

Children under 15 make up 21.7% of the population, which is well above the national figure of 18.2%. Meanwhile, seniors aged 65 and over represent 15.2%, a little below the state and national averages.

Identity & relationships

First Nations identity and marital status.

About 4.4% of residents are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ander, which is a little above the national figure. Most people are married (52.5%), while those in de facto relationships account for 11.6%.
